But, after doing some research there are a few things I really like about this approach.
1. A friend of mine at church is doing it, so we can encourage each other. And. I. really. need. accountability. Going to ww meetings is just really hard at this stage in my life, so the support of a dear friend, who I see twice a week will be wonderful.
2. The diet is very healthy, using good fats, olive oil, nuts, avacados, and could I mention dark chocolate? They claim this is the key to getting rid of the belly fat. The MUFAs (Monounsaturated fatty acids) are very beneficial to your body.
3. They give you actual meal plans and menus to follow. This way I don't have to think. I have enough decisions in my life. It will be nice to be told what to eat. :)
